Sweet Lassi (Meethi lassi)
Also called: sweet lassi, meethi lassi, meethi lassie, meethi lassi (sweet), sweetlassi, meethilassi, meethi-lassi, lassi sweet
Sweet lassi is that chilled, creamy dahi drink you often get in a tall glass at dhabas, summer lunches, or after a spicy meal. Meethi lassi feels comforting and familiar — a little sweet, a little tangy, and super refreshing when the heat is real.
Per 1 tall glass (250g)
Nutrition Facts
| Nutrient | Per tall glass (250g) | Per 100g |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 89.3 kcal | 35.7 kcal |
| Protein | 3.3g | 1.3g |
| Carbohydrates | 16.3g | 6.5g |
| Fat | 1.8g | 0.7g |
| Fiber | 0g | 0g |
| Sugar | 16.3g | 6.5g |
| Micronutrients (per 100g) | ||
| Sodium | 18.31 mg | |
| Calcium | 45.65 mg | |
| Iron | 0.03 mg | |
| Vitamin C | 1 mg | |
| Folate | 18 µg | |

gastroenterology Gut Health Insight
Since this lassi is made from curd, it brings in some natural probiotics that can support your gut microbes and help digestion. The curds also add a bit of protein and calcium, so it’s more nourishing than plain sugary drinks. But the sugar pushes up the carb load without adding fiber, so it can give a quick energy spike. A good tip: pair it with a fiber-rich meal like roti, sabzi, or chana, so the sweetness doesn’t hit too fast and the gut gets more balanced support.
